Japanese Porcelain Vase, late 19th century (c. 1850–1899) This finely crafted Japanese porcelain vase is decorated in the moriage technique, featuring meticulously hand-painted and raised enamels forming an architectural pagoda motif. Executed in a refined multi-colour palette, the decoration demonstrates a high level of technical skill and aesthetic sensitivity characteristic of Japanese ceramic production during the latter half of the 19th century. An authentic antique work, the vase reflects the artistic traditions and cultural symbolism of the period and stands as a representative example of Japanese decorative arts.
